1.2) Biography

Born on the 9th March 759 A. S. on Planet Los Angeles as son of a sales manager of the local Synth Foods company. Upon graduating from the Marshall School of Business he started his own small transport business with the financial support of his father.
After expanding from domestic market of Liberty to the import-export business one of his employees got in touch with Omicron Supply Industries.


Realizing that as independent contractor of OSI he could reach into markets he had never imagined to see, he signed a contract with OSI that allowed him to fly under Zoner colors without actually giving up his own company.
The success of this cooperation soon caught the eyes of others and as his personal wealth grew so did his reputation within OSI. His ruthlessness in conquering new markets and exploitation of market opportunities made him both feared as competitor and respected as colleague among his peers.

He relocated the headquarter of his contract-business to an office within the OSI-headquarter on Planet Gran Canaria, where he felt more as an integral part of OSI than a mere subcontractor.
However, his rise within the ranks of OSI only began as Kelly on numerous occasions overstepped his competence and made deal on behalf of OSI, while fulfilling them with his contractual company.

In the end he was found out and had to explain himself in front of the directors. Due to the fact that all of his customers were full of praise – which he skillfully emphasized – and the support of the then-directors Caudill and Church he was promoted to Adviser of the board and continued to sign contracts on behalf of OSI legally.
With the retirement of both Caudill and Church new director position became available and with the new CEO VonCloud he began to take OSI into new directions, that included his aggressive approach to new markets.

After VonCloud stepped down, Kelly was nominated CEO and continued the success story that was Omicron Supply Industries. However, as time progressed, the position of CEO became more and more the position of the head of a political entity. Kelly was well out of his comfort zone as business negotiation became political statements. Not being or wanting to be a political figure he retired from the position as OSI’s CEO and went back to liberty.

However, his retirement was cut short as he was approached to restructure the slowly fading Interspace Commerce. Seeing an opportunity to be a pure businessman again, he took on the challenge. After bringing Interspace Commerce back on the road to success, Kelly settled for the position of Chairman

The position of a non-executive Chairman of the board of directors gave Kelly both ample influence on the company as well as representing his favorite kind of people on the board of directors: The shareholders.

Not being an active part in the day-to-day business of Interspace Commerce shielded Kelly from much of the stress of management positions and provides him with some spare time. So it was not uncommon to see him mentoring on the liberty chamber of commerce, writing the odd article about best practices in the world of business or following his hobbies.

But as time went on the Board of Interspace Commerce grew complacent and listened less and less to the advice of their most senior Member, he left IC, to focus on growing his own business.

However, another Libertonian company did not agree with Kellys plans and recruited him back into the corporate world: Cryer Pharmaceuticals and the all around carefree healthcare offered by Cryer to convince him to stay, was too good an offer to reject for Kelly, who has started to feel the effect of age.

1.3 Privately Owned companies

13.1 Kelly Import & Export LLC

Arguably the first Business of Kelly, was funded mainly by his father and a loan from IC. Due to personal connection it initially focused on exporting Synth Gel and importing Luxury Food. As business expanded to did the routes.

Later KI&E LLC became a defacto subsidiary of Omicron Supply Industries, due to the fact that OSI did not employ but contracted their people. A loophole allowed to get contracted as a legal person, that being his business. With access to the trading database of OSI, he made sure to score the most profitable jobs and invested the money in more and better ships and hiring more personal. Eventually he stopped flying and started to manage his company full time. In it’s prime the company employed over 50 people and 12 ships.

This arrangement lasted till Kelly retired from OSI. Today, KI&E LLC consists of a mere 2 ships, both of them under the colors of Interspace Commerce and Kelly is rumored to get into the pilot seat from time to time, though enough personal is employed to keep both ships flying profitably.

1.3.2 Kelly Stock Exchange LLC

Trading Stocks and Bonds is a major hobby of Jason Kelly, so much so he funded his own facility and network allow him to trade on his own terms, as Planet Gran Canaria had not legislated the stock-market, unlike the houses.

This attracted investors and gamblers, who were willing to rent access to Kellys network. Thus Kelly Stock Exchange was born. An office complex named "Las Palmas Interstellar Stock Market" was built and offices in it were rented to all people willing to trade stocks there.

The newest addition to KSE is a Nephilim-Class Carrier, which serves as mobile stock market, even though some might see it as a cruise-liner that gives you the possibility to earn back the price of the cruise on board.

Today Kelly Stock Exchange is the biggest contributor to Kellys income, though exact numbers are not available for public record.

1.4.2: Ships

14.2.1: The Whale



The ship, affectionatly known as “the wale” went under some different names, most notably the HeavenlyBurden under the flag of Omicron Supply Industries and Gruetli-Laager for IC. The simple fact is, that this was the first ZBT-1002 that Kelly has ever flown and gotten very fond of the nice handling and the sleek curves of the ship.

Everything about the ship is customized to the conditions of the borderworlds. Such as the additional armor, as it was used in dangerous parts of space, spacious living quarters because of the long journeys, an improved navigational array as well as a docking bay for a small craft.

She was twice subject to a complete overhaul and modernization of it's systems and propulsion while flying for OSI. The latest overhaul was in early 822 A.S. and the ship was equipped with the newest technologies as part of the new fleet of Interspace Commerce and rechristened Gruetli-Laager.

Even the upgrades from Renzu shipyard didn’t change anything about the borderworld customization but only upgraded to the transponder and the communication-array.

1.4.2.2: The gunboat

Kelly is quite fond of repurposing gunboats as personal yachts, whereas everyone else of his tax class uses liners for that purpose.

And it has been his personal policy to conduct business-trips in a gunboat since his early days as a director of OSI. They are big enough to command some respect and be comfortable, small enough to not draw too much attention and, lastly, powerful enough to get out of trouble, should the situation demand it.

The successor of his conference gunboat from his times in Omicron Supply Industries is a CTE-12400 "Condor" Civilian Gunboat. The Tell-City hat been a gift from Interspace Commerce, a sweetener to get out of retirement. The fully customized gunboat exemplifies the use as personal yacht, sporting a conference room, spacious living quarters and an actual kitchen, should one ever bother to cook.

While the interior has been heavily modified the outside just looks like a regular gunboat, to not draw any unwanted attention.

1.4.1.3: The Nephilim

The InterstellarAmbitions is the Nephilim employed by Kelly Stock Exchange. It might be the only privately owned Nephilim in existence, as the Nephilim is hard to come by and expensive to sustain. However, as with gunboats Kelly does not use it as a combat-vessel and uses it as a mobile stock-market.

Internally it resembles much more a flying supercomputer than a ship built for combat. There are plenty of offices crammed between the computer core and the hull. And the cabins resemble those of a coach-version of a liner. However, there are some basic recreational facilities to satisfy the customer's need for entertainment and recreation.

Since much of the powercore is dedicated to run a plethora of computers and state-of-the-art data-links to the colonies the defensive capabilities of the ship is somewhat limited in terms of response time, as the computers have to be shut down first, before the guns can be powered.

1.4.3: Real Estate

The runner up to the biggest office complex on Gran Canaria is the “Las Palmas Interstellar Stock Market”. It is therefore one of the significant marks on the skyline of Las Palmas. It is part and heart of “Kelly Stock Exchange LLC” and a major contributor to the economy of the city.

Rumor has it that this building or rather it’s power consumption is responsible for the outage of 822. However, as the growth of the City has slowed down to manageable rates, LPISM is providing reliable services to anyone renting an office in the complex and thus access to it’s proprietary stock-exchange network.

It’s proximity to the Headquarters of Omicron Supply Industries and the Trade’n’Drunk are reminders that, at the time of groundbreaking, Kelly was a young Director of Omicron Supply Industries with ambitions as high as the complex’ main building.

1.5 The team around Jason Kelly

Nobody owns and manages two businesses while simultaneously working at the highest corporate level without some help. To that end Jason Kelly employs some of the brightest people in Sirius. The most noteworthy people in that team are:

Tokugawa Ieyasu: Science advisor

Of Kusari origin and with PhDs in Biology and Physics Ieyasu’s field of expertise are the polar opposite of Kelly’s. Hence why he advises his boss in all questions of science or math. However, he shares the passion for playing Go.
His day-to-day business consists of keeping up with the current advances of science, which is mostly reading newly published papers, but includes going to conventions and symposiums.

Owen Atkinson: Lead Project Manager


While Kelly might be considered a man of vision, the Bretonian Atkinson is a man of plans. His keen eye for crucial details and ability to keep on top of the events of complicated projects.
With an MBA from Cambridge and ample experience in project management, he translates the Visions of Kelly into plans and sets those into action.

Monika Fasnacht: PR-Expert


The Zoner-Born Ms. Fasnacht studied international relations in New Berlin, before returning to Cran Canaria to advise businesses small and large about international and business-relations. Fluent in Gallic, Rheinlandish and Sirian Standard and Author of a cross-culture study in nuances of communication.
